Emerging Technologies Revolutionizing iGaming
Technology is at the heart of the iGaming revolution. From virtual reality to blockchain, several cutting-edge tools are reshaping how games are developed, played, and managed.
-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R): These immersive technologies are creating more engaging and realistic casino experiences, allowing players to interact in virtual environments that mimic real-world casinos.
- Artificial Intelligence (AI): AI enhances personalized gaming by analyzing player behavior, optimizing game recommendations, and improving customer support through chatbots.
- Blockchain and Cryptocurrencies: Blockchain ensures transparency and security in transactions, while cryptocurrencies offer faster and more anonymous payment options.
- Cloud Gaming: Cloud technology enables instant game access without the need for downloads, improving accessibility across devices.

Popular Game Types and Player Preferences
The diversity of game offerings is a significant factor in attracting and retaining players. Here’s a breakdown of the most popular iGaming categories and what players are looking for:
| Game Type | Description | Player Appeal |
|---|---|---|
| Slots | Digital versions of classic slot machines with various themes and bonus features. | Easy to play, high entertainment value, frequent jackpots. |
| Live Dealer Games | Real-time games streamed with professional dealers. | Authentic casino experience, social interaction. |
| Sports Betting | Wagering on sports events with dynamic odds. | Engages sports fans, offers strategic betting options. |
| eSports Betting | Betting on competitive video gaming tournaments. | Attracts younger demographics, fast-paced action. |
| Table Games | Classic games like poker, blackjack, and roulette. | Skill-based, strategic, and traditional appeal. |
